The Property Administrator ensures that assigned properties within his/her portfolio are operated and maintained in a cost-effective, safe and efficient manner.

The Property Administrator supports the Property/Facilities Manager in this activity. The role of Property Administrator is key to maintaining strong tenant relationships in both our residential and commercial properties.


Key Responsibilities

  • Perform entry of payables, including coding and data input.
  • Accounts receivable.
  • Entry of all deposits and maintain records as necessary.
  • Complete tenant statement of accounts.
  • Respond to tenant queries regarding charges.
  • Complete Rental Advice Notices to new tenants and all tenants annually.
  • Keep track of tenant rental step ups and send notices to tenant.
  • Complete monthly AR reports with updates on any arrears.
  • Preparation of deposit slip for delivery to bank.
  • Assist the Property/Facilities Manager with collection activities.
  • Complete annual rent increase notices for residential tenants.
  • Complete all notifications for residential tenancy collection enforcement including N4's and other documents.
  • Carry out proper notices for late payment, eviction, etc., for residential tenants.
  • Track tenant commencement dates in order to ensure proper accounting and rent commencement.
  • Prepare and ensure tenant execution of residential leases.
  • Prepare request for credit checks and background checks on residential tenancies.
  • Maintain current tenant contact information and update Yardi.
  • Compile and distribute percentage rent invoices.
  • Collect all tenant invoices.
  • Prepare rent commencement letters for welcoming new tenants.
  • Prepare tenant chargeback invoices.
